Stefano's wife just had their second child, so he doesn't have much time to go to the restaurant right now, but he still gave us a very good tip:

A Palazzo

Phone 0583-965-341
Location Via S. Giusto Brancoli 3160 - 55100 (LUCCA), north of Lucca, up 10 km along the Sergio River take highway SS12 toward Abetone. Take the first exit for Ponte A Moriano, drive through the village, in the next village look for signs for Brancoli, Omgreglio, Gignano on your right. After 100 mts turn left toward S. Giusto di Brancoli. The restaurant is 3 km up that (very narrow!) road.
Prices medium range, antipasti, main dish, dessert, wine, water 15 -20 euros p.p.

"I really like this restaurant for summer dinning because it has large outdoor seating that provides a spectacular view of Lucca. The interior is equally charming, very rustic and homey. The food is country Tuscan, made simply with fresh ingredients. Some of my favorite dishes include: Spicey Stewed Wild Boar (Cinghale), and Tortelli in Ragu (like a spiced meat raviolli in a red meat sauce). I had a good local wine there once called, Maulina that I would recommend to anyone ordering for the first time. The road going up is farely narrow so take it slowly. Also, parking can be tricky in the summer."
